Information Analysis:
Centres An Information Analysis Centre (IAC) has been defined as an organization which indexes, abstracts, translates, reviews, synthesizes, and evaluates information and/or data in clearly defined specialized fields. The key activities of IAC are collection, analysis, interpretation, synthesis, evaluation and repackaging of information or numerical data. The IAC is the most efficient system for transferring authoritative and evaluated information to a user in a convenient form.
